Teimuraz Janjalia has met with the Croatian ambassador

On 13 June 2023, the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s, Teimuraz Janjalia, held a meeting with the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Republic of Croatia to Georgia (with residence in Baku), Branko Zebić.

At the meeting, the sides reviewed the issues of bilateral cooperation on the agenda. Special emphasis was put on the importance of opening the Embassy of Georgia to Croatia. The sides also expressed the readiness to activate a regular political dialogue.

The conversation also touched on the process of Georgia's integration into the European Union. The deputy minister provided the Croatian ambassador with detailed information about the reforms implemented by Georgia and the progress achieved in the process of implementing the European Commission’s 12 recommendations. In this context, the sides paid special attention to the importance of partners’ firm support in this process.
